A CULLINGWORTH businessman helped boost funds for terminally-ill children in a global charity extravaganza.

Andrew Vaux, director of ARVA PR & Events, joined clients from property firm Keller Williams for the company’s annual charity event.

Every year, the firm's agents take part in RED Day – 'Renew Energise Donate' – which involves more than 800 offices across the globe raising funds for local charities.

Mr Vaux was recently appointed to help manage public relations for the company across Yorkshire.

He visited the firm's county base, where activities included agents hitting the phones to secure donations from local companies and charity collections at a number of locations.

He and his colleagues raised more than £600, with pledges still coming in. They hope to boost the funds further by taking part in a charity boat race later in the summer.

All the money will go to Levi’s Star – a charity that supports children with brain tumours and their families throughout Yorkshire.

Mr Vaux said: “Over the years, I’ve always done a lot of work to support charities, including Manorlands, Macmillan Cancer Support and Christian Aid.

"When I heard RED Day 2016 was being organised, I was delighted to step forward and help.”
